The answer to 'why is my AC not cooling' is that there are several common causes, including a refrigerant leak, a problem with the compressor, a clogged air filter, or issues with the thermostat or electrical components. Symptoms may include warm air blowing from the vents, the unit running constantly, or the system not turning on at all.
If your AC is not cooling effectively, the first thing to check is the air filter. A clogged filter can restrict airflow and prevent proper cooling. You can try changing the filter yourself. If that doesn't solve the issue, it's best to call in a professional HVAC technician to diagnose and repair the problem. They can check for refrigerant leaks, compressor issues, or other problems that require more advanced troubleshooting and repairs.
